Name Contest Results

Dear Friends,
The results of the final round of the name contest are conclusive: Knights and Ladies of the Flame received the most votes and will therefore remain the name of our youth movement going forward.
We want to give a big thank you to all those who participated in the voting process from start to finish, as we really see this milestone as a great success. As contentious as the preceding dialogue proved to be at times, we had record amounts of participation in the vote from members all over the world, created a previously non-existent forum for a broad spectrum of voices and perspectives, and of course, we achieved the final settlement of an issue that has been debated internally for quite some time.
As we move on from the conclusion of this process, we ask that regardless of which side of the vote each of us fell on, that we all do our parts to help move this group forward positively and proactively as one unified body. If we can engage each other at anywhere close to the same intensity that we have over recent weeks, we can make serious progress in helping our community to grow, strengthen our bonds of friendship and fulfill the mission and vision we set for ourselves (see below). You can be assured the Advisory Committee will continue pursuing new possibilities, and we hope you will join us in that quest.
KLF Mission: Our mission is to provide a community that helps youth realize and fulfill their potential to become God.
KLF Vision: We envision a global community built on friendship, where youth from all walks of life are both progressing towards and achieving their Christhood. Day by day, they apply the teachings of the Ascended Masters to their personal lives, actively transforming their communities and the world into a Golden Age.
